Nexo’s Strategic Return:

Nexo’s exit from the US in late 2022 was attributed to regulatory uncertainties. Subsequently, the company reached a settlement with the SEC, addressing concerns about its interest-earning product. This settlement, along with the closure of its US-based interest-earning product, paved the way for its strategic return. The company’s decision to return signals a renewed commitment to the US market and a belief in the evolving regulatory landscape.

Shifting Regulatory Landscape:

The recent appointment of Paul Atkins as SEC Chair has sparked optimism within the crypto industry. Industry leaders are hopeful that Atkins’ leadership will foster a more constructive regulatory approach, balancing innovation and investor protection. This positive shift in regulatory sentiment may have played a pivotal role in Nexo’s decision to re-enter the US market.
